PGS Student Abby Bools Named C-USA Co-Golfer-of-the-Year

PGS student and East Carolina senior, Abby Bools, was named Conference USA Co-Golfer-of-the-Year, as selected by the 10 league head coaches last Monday. Bools is one of three standouts to claim the Player-of-the-Year trophy multiple times in the leagues 15 year history.   Culminating her senior year, she claims the titles of four-time Academic All-American, three-time first team All…
